Filters:
Country:
Region:
City:
Similar words:
taco restaurant in France
About 54 results.
SMN SIGN AND PRINT LTD
Perrymount Road 52, RH16 3DT Haywards Heath, United KingdomWe are a trade printer with over 20 years experience in the printing business we specialise in Design, Large Format, Digital & Litho Printing.